Event Details
The Doubleclicks are a folk-pop sibling duo, featuring clever lyrics about dinosaurs, literature, love and the Internet—with a cello, guitar, and meowing kitten keyboard. Their latest CD Love Problems debuted at number one on the Billboard comedy albums chart, and they’ve toured the world at conventions, comedy festivals and more. Their songs are frequently featured on BoingBoing, Kotaku, Huffington Post, and on NPR shows Live Wire, All Things Acoustic, and State of Wonder.
This concert is free and open to all. Doors open at 6:30pm. This special event is a part of Salem Reads 2019, hosted by the Salem Public Library Foundation.
